Abstract
Surface roughness on a flat object causes natural speckle when imaged by an extreme ultraviolet (EUV) microscope under sufficient coherence. Using a phase-to-intensity transfer function theory, direct estimation of aberrations from the spectrum of the speckle intensity is demonstrated for various illumination angles.
